#ed5100 Color Information
In a RGB color space, hex #ed5100 is composed of 92.9% red, 31.8% green and 0% blue. Whereas in a CMYK color space, it is composed of 0% cyan, 65.8% magenta, 100% yellow and 7.1% black. It has a hue angle of 20.5 degrees, a saturation of 100% and a lightness of 46.5%. #ed5100 color hex could be obtained by blending #ffa200 with #db0000. Closest websafe color is: #ff6600.

							Shades and Tints of #ed5100
A shade is achieved by adding black to any pure hue, while a tint is created by mixing white to any pure color. In this example, #020100 is the darkest color, while #fff3ed is the lightest one.
